Output 285b89eeb89e71b42aeb4055d0409826fd511dba02981ee6a3193d89ea1663c3:1

value
6642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842c18dbf035b5a66bef4a412068a826326d893d OP_EQUAL
address
3DjswnYPBzi73k1JzpWGNdwSfwk1NYFthk
transaction
285b89eeb89e71b42aeb4055d0409826fd511dba02981ee6a3193d89ea1663c3
confirmations
325904
spent
true